How much do construction accounting clerk j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for construction accounting clerk in the United States is $20.63,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.79 and $22.84 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a construction accounting clerk do?

A construction accounting clerk handles financial recordkeeping for construction projects, including processing invoices, managing accounts payable and receivable, and maintaining financial documents. They often use accounting software and need attention to detail to ensure accurate project budgeting and cost tracking.

What is a construction accounting clerk?

Construction Accounting Clerks are professionals who handle financial and administrative tasks specific to the construction industry. They are responsible for processing invoices, tracking expenses, managing payroll, and ensuring that project budgets are maintained accurately. They often work closely with project managers, vendors, and other accounting staff to keep financial records organized and up to date. Their work helps construction companies monitor costs, comply with regulations, and maintain profitability.

Is construction accounting difficult?

Construction accounting can be complex due to the need to manage multiple projects, budgets, and contracts, requiring attention to detail and understanding of industry-specific financial practices. It often involves using specialized software and understanding job costs, progress billing, and compliance requirements, making it a challenging but manageable role for those with relevant skills and exper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a construction accounting clerk?

To thrive as a Construction Accounting Clerk, you need a solid understanding of accounting principles, attention to detail, and experience with construction billing and cost tracking, often supported by an associate degree or relevant coursework. Familiarity with industry-specific accounting software such as Sage 300 Construction and Real Estate or QuickBooks, and proficiency in Microsoft Excel are typically required. Strong organizational skills,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ication help you manage multiple tasks and collaborate with project teams. These skills ensure accurate financial records, timely payments, and smooth project operations in the construction environment.

Is a construction accounting clerk a stressful job?

A construction accounting clerk's job can be stressful during busy periods such as month-end closing or project deadlines, as it involves managing financial records, invoices, and budgets accurately. The role requires attention to detail, organizational skills, and proficiency with accounting software, which can contribute to workload pressure but also offers a structured environment. Overall, stress levels depend on workload, company size, and individual coping strategies.

How does a construction accounting clerk typically interact with project managers and site supervisors?

Construction Accounting Clerks play a key role in facilitating communication between the accounting department and project teams. They regularly coordinate with project managers and site supervisors to collect timesheets, verify job costs, and ensure that invoices and purchase orders are accurately processed. This collaboration helps maintain up-to-date financial records for each project and allows for quick resolution of any discrepancies. By working closely with on-site staff, Construction Accounting Clerks help ensure compliance with budgets and company policies.

Job description

Summary

For more than 40 years, Empire Construction has partnered with clients across the country to deliver exceptional retail, restaurant, hospitality, healthcare, industrial, and commercial construction projects. Founded in 1982 as a family-owned business in Santa Ana, California, Empire has grown into a nationally respected general contractor by building lasting relationships, exceeding client expectations, and maintaining an unwavering commitment to quality.

We are seeking a Project Accountant who thrives in a fast-paced environment and is passionate about accuracy, accountability, and delivering results. This position is responsible for the full-cycle job cost and contract accounting functions for construction projects, including project billing, job cost tracking, financial reporting, invoice processing, and maintaining accurate project documentation. The Project Accountant works closely with project teams, customers, vendors, and internal stakeholders to ensure financial accuracy, compliance, and exceptional customer service.

If you're looking to join a growing company where your contributions matter, your performance is recognized, and you have the opportunity to learn, grow, and advance your career, Empire Construction is the place for you. We are committed to building a team of professionals who take ownership, maintain a positive attitude, collaborate to achieve shared success, and continually raise the standard of excellence. At Empire, we don't settle for "good enough"; we challenge ourselves to exceed expectations and deliver outstanding results for our clients and each other.

 Essential Functions

 

  • Review AP invoices, code, and enter
  • Maintain project-related records, including contracts and change orders
  • Authorize the transfer of expenses into and out of project-related accounts
  • Track appropriate Lien Releases for assigned projects
  • Create and submit AIA billing to subcontractors
  • Work closely with the Project Engineers and Project Managers to ensure financial performance and necessary budget updates
  • Assist in investigating, reconciling, and balancing project costs
  • Verify the accuracy of invoices and other accounting documents or records
  • Reconcile records with internal company employees and management, or external vendors and customers
  • Compile data and prepare a variety of reports
  • Provide clerical & administrative support and assist with special projects, as directed by the Accounting Manager
  • General bookkeeping tasks and accounting operations support
  • Review purchase orders for appropriate documentation and approval prior to posting invoices
  • Update and maintain customer and vendor databases using Sage & Procore
  • Utilize computer tools such as Procore, Sage, Excel, Word, Outlook, and Adobe, as well as online meeting and collaboration software
  • Maintain files and documentation thoroughly and accurately, in accordance with company policy and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)
  • Participate in the organization and execution of accounting projects as required. Professionally represent the company, and manage and maintain customer relationships through prompt, clear, and consistent communication
  • Perform additional duties as assigned

 

Core Skills and Competencies

 

  • Extensive construction billing experience is required, including preparation, submission, and management of AIA progress billings
  • Proficiency in Sage, Microsoft Excel, Word, and Outlook, with experience using Procore for project management and billing administration
  • Strong organizational and time management skills, with the 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ks simultaneously while meeting deadlines
  • Strong clerical skills, including effective phone and email communication, document filing, and general computer proficiency
  • Professional demeanor with sound judgment, discretion, and maturity in handling confidential information
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to effectively engage with customers, co-workers, and stakeholders
  • Strong team player with the ability to collaborate efficiently in a dynamic work environment

 

Education and Experience

 

  • Minimum of 2-5 years of experience in an accounting role, preferably within the construction billing experience
